Feds opening Canada to more foreign grandparents, parents

posted Nov 12, 2011, 4:13 PM by Milorad Borota
By Tom Zytaruk, Surrey Now November 8, 2011

Immigration Minister Jason Kenney revealed the new plan Friday to let 10,000 more parents and grandparents into the country each year - to a total of 25,000 - by way of a new multiple-entry 10-year "super visa" that will permit stays of up to two years at a time. Currently, of about 40,000 parents and grandparents who apply to visit their children and grandchildren in Canada each year, about 17,000 get in.
